The Evolution of Online Sports Betting
Sports betting has actually existed for centuries, however its shift to the online sphere was a game-changer. The introduction of digital betting platforms in the late 1990s and early 2000s produced a more dynamic and accessible method for sports lovers to put wagers. With improvements in innovation, mobile applications, and real-time data analytics, betting platforms have become more sophisticated, using users live betting, gamer props, and even esports wagering.
Online sportsbooks supply various advantages over traditional bookmakers. The ease of use, capability to position bets from anywhere, and access to real-time stats and odds make online platforms the preferred option for numerous bettors. Furthermore, the range of betting choices has actually broadened beyond easy moneyline bets to include spreads, totals, parlays, teasers, and in-game betting, producing an immersive experience for users.

Legal and Regulatory Challenges
In spite of the rapid development of online sports betting, the industry stays based on various legal and regulatory difficulties. The legality of online sports betting differs by nation and, in the United States, by state. The repeal of the Professional and Amateur Sports Protection Act (PASPA) in 2018 enabled private states to legislate sports betting, causing a surge in online sportsbooks entering the market.
Nevertheless, overseas sportsbooks like BetOnline run in a legal gray area in the U.S. While the platform is certified internationally, it is not regulated by any U.S. gaming commission. This indicates that although Americans can utilize BetOnline, they do so at their own discretion, as the platform does not use the same consumer protections as domestically licensed sportsbooks.
Numerous states have actually chosen to release their own regulated sports betting markets, with significant gamers like DraftKings, FanDuel, and BetMGM protecting licenses. While this has actually provided bettors with more choices, offshore sportsbooks continue to attract users due to better odds, higher betting limits, and fewer restrictions.
